My name is Dee and I have read some of the stories on your web page and have noticed that a lot of the people were older than I was when they found out about this disease so I thought I would let u all know that somebody out there has had their intestines removed at an early age(1 wk old to be precise).

Anyway I was born in 1969 in Riverside, Calf. and I was brought home and brought back to the hospital a week after I was born I was vomiting up feces and losing a lot of weight so when I got to the hospital they found out that my small intestines were  backwards so they turned them the right way and gangrene set in so they took all but 17cm of my small and some of my large.

I was in the hospital for 3 yrs straight then in and out for 3 more because I was failing to eat and when I did eat it all went right through me .I just recently received my medical records from 1969-1972 and I noticed the weight I lost was unbelievable I was 6 pounds 0 ounces when I was born and by the time my mom brought me in a week later I had lost4 ounces that may not seem like much, but after reading the charts more I seen that I had lost even more during my  visits at home. Anyway I guess they didn't have transplants back then I was also told that in 1969 there were only 6 cases plus mine in the US. now today

I am 34 yrs old I am 4'8 and 76-80 pounds and I have never hit 100 pounds. I am in the restroom a lot I have stomach problems, and I get accused of being anorexic which really hurts sometimes. I just recently had a surgery done to get rid of some of the scar tissue out of my stomach and also in my reproductive organs, the doctors seem to think I was nut's getting pregnant because of the scar tissue and that also could have been the reason why my back hurt. I do know that scar tissues grow back so I might have to get it done in 5 or 6 yrs, but so far the only problems I have that will not go away is stomach pain and the embarrassment of using the restroom

Anyway I am writing this in hopes that someone knows or has heard of another case like mine there are still 5 of us left I think, so if anyone knows someone who has gotten their small intestines out in the 1960's please let me know, I am so thankful for this website I thought I was the only one in the world feeling like this.
